Well from what I can see of mine, RID Cliffjumper's neck is where the peg is and that inserts into a socket where the base of his neck is. WFC Cliffjumper is the opposite, His head has the socket and his neck is a peg. You have to do a bit of customizing to get it to work. Also the RID head is a bit smaller, so he'd look a bit silly. It may work with the FE Cliffjumper, but I dunno if you'd want to spend all that money to make WFC Cliffjumper look right.
